Calvin Klein Collection presented his Fall 2016 Calvin Klein Collection on the runway at Spring Studios in Tribeca this afternoon. The runway show was also streamed live online and will be available tomorrow for viewing at live.calvinklein.com.

Mr. Costa presented his latest collection to an audience that included notable guests actress Margot Robbie; Kendall Jenner, Abbey Lee Kershaw and Adwoa Aboah, who each currently appear in the Spring 2016 Calvin Klein global advertising campaign; Zoe Kravitz & Twin Shadow; Korean musician CL, as well as key editors, stylists, retailers and influencers.

This season, the collection represented a sensual exploration of urban eroticism, deconstructed proportions and luxe fabrics.

The interplay between his and hers dressing continues to be key, with suits comprised of precisely tailored jackets and soft wide leg trousers. Light and sultry shift dresses are emphasized by deep v necklines and unraveled hems. Inspired by the unfettered nature inherent in both the city and the wild, the collection features an unexpected assortment of plaid, Prince of Wales check, and pinstripe prints as well as oversized faux fur collars and gloves and digital coyote, lynx and skunk prints.

A striking culmination of dresses reveals exquisite polished stone and geode inserts; further emphasizing the juxtaposition of refined luxury and untamed wild. The contrast of masculine and feminine sensibilities persists with the season’s footwear silhouettes focusing on either ankle strap stilettos or elevated oxfords.
